While many IRAs invest in conventional possessions like stocks or shared funds, the tax code also allows unique "self-directed" or "alternative-asset" Individual retirement accounts that can hold physical silver or gold. But not all valuable metals are allowed. united gold direct - ira/401k gold rollover. In reality, the law names particular gold, silver and platinum coins that certify like the American Gold Eagle and defines pureness requirements for gold, silver, platinum or palladium bars in such accounts.

The tax code also says the gold or silver must be held by an IRS-approved custodian or trustee, though some gold IRA marketers claim there's a loophole in this law (more about this later). But the proof is blended on whether owning gold can actually keep your cost savings safe. For starters, while gold can offer some insurance coverage against inflation, just how much depends upon your timing and patience. "Gold does tend to hold its value in the long-lasting, but it is also unstable approximately as volatile as stocks so you may require decades to ride out its ups and downs," states Campbell Harvey, the J.

" So gold would be at the bottom of the list for people who are retired or near retirement." From 1981 through 2000, for instance, when inflation nearly doubled, gold went more or less sideways. Then in this century, the metal truly removed - 401k rollover into gold. It increased by more than 500% from January 2000 (when it traded at around $280 per ounce) to a high of approximately $1,900 in August 2011, while inflation climbed up only 34%. Considering that then, nevertheless, gold has fallen by about a third in value, to around $1,270 an ounce in mid-June, while inflation edged up 8%.

The Lear Capital TV advertisement, for example, says that, "if silver just goes back to half of its all-time high, it would be a 60% increase." Fair enough. However if it sagged to around twice its recent low, you would suffer a really unpleasant 50% loss. That's why even investors who usually favor gold, such as Russ Koesterich, a portfolio supervisor for the Black, Rock Global Allotment Fund, encourage you to treat rare-earth elements with the exact same care you would any other physical asset, such as real estate. With time, home tends to increase in worth. But in a down market, like the 2008 economic crisis, individuals can lose their shirts and houses to plunging costs. 401k gold rollover.

Where is gold headed? Investment pros provide no consensus (rollover 401k into gold ira). Koesterich states a modest quantity of gold in a portfolio (say, 3 to 5%) may assist provide diversity if other assets downturn. But Harvey and previous commodities trader Claude Erb argue that gold's big gain during the 2000s left the metal extremely misestimated compared to historical norms. In a paper released last year, they computed that if gold returned to its "fair value" compared to inflation over the next ten years, it would lose about 4. 4% a year. "You can head out and purchase a Treasury Inflation-Protected Security, or TIPS, that will give you the exact same return with a lot less volatility," Erb points out.

Treasury bond whose principal is guaranteed to increase with inflation.) The IDEAS contrast brings up one crucial distinction in between valuable metals and other investments: they have no income stream, such as the interest on a bond or dividends from a stock, to cushion their rate swings. What's more, precious metals have significant purchase and holding costs that stocks and bonds don't share. For starters, there are base costs and storage expenses. At Rosland Capital, you'll pay a one-time $50 fee to open an account and around $225 a year to store and guarantee your holdings at a protected depository in northern Delaware.

However they make that refund on an even more considerable cost: the "spread," or space between the wholesale price the business pays to acquire the metal and the market price it charges you as a purchaser. Lear Capital, for instance, just recently offered an IRA Reward Program that picked up $500 of charges for consumers who bought at least $50,000 in silver or gold. However the company's Deal Contract said the spread on coins and bullion sold to IRA consumers "typically" ranged between 17 and 33%. So if the spread were 17%, a consumer who opened a $50,000 Individual Retirement Account would pay $8,500 for the spread and get just $41,500 in wholesale-value gold which left a lot of margin for Lear to recoup that $500 bonus offer.

If you sell the gold or silver to a third-party dealer, you might lose cash on another spread, since dealers usually desire to pay less than what they think they can get for the metal on the free market (gold rollover 401k). To assist clients prevent that risk, some IRA companies will purchase back your gold at, say, the then-prevailing wholesale price. Nevertheless, thanks to the initial spread our theoretical financier paid to open her $50,000 IRA, she would need gold rates to rise by over 20% simply to recover cost. Compare that to the expense of a traditional IRA, where opening and closing an account is often complimentary and transactions may cost simply $8 per trade.

However expect disaster really does strike. How would you redeem your gold if it's sitting in a depository midway across the nation? To resolve that concern, a few alternative Individual Retirement Account consultants point to a wrinkle in the tax code that they say could let you save your rare-earth elements close by such as in a regional bank safe deposit box or at house. Essentially, the company helps you set up what's called a limited liability business (LLC) and place that business into a self-directed Individual Retirement Account. The LLC then purchases the gold and selects where to save it. The drawback to this method is that it appears to run counter to the wishes of the Internal Revenue Service (Internal Revenue Service).

Tax issues aside, financial professionals state there is a much more cost-effective method to include gold to your retirement portfolio: buy an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) that tracks the rate of the metal. These funds like SPDR Gold Shares, IShares Gold Trust, ETFS Physical Swiss Gold Shares and others are essentially trusts that own vast quantities of gold bullion - 401k to gold ira rollover guide. SPDR Gold, for instance, has nearly $34 billion in gold bars tucked in a huge underground vault in London where workers in titanium-toed shoes drive the stuff around on forklifts.

There's no minimum investment except the cost of a single share, which just recently ranged from around $5 to roughly $120, depending upon the ETF. And since the funds purchase and store gold wholesale, their business expenses are relatively low (rollover 401k to gold ira). SPDR Gold's annual expenses are capped at 4/10 of a percent of holdings annually, for example, or somewhere between the cost of an index fund and an actively managed fund. "So we are able to bring the cost-efficiency of the wholesale market to specific investors," states George Milling-Stanley, head of gold strategy at State Street Global Advisors, the marketing agent for SPDR Gold - gold rollover 401k.

For lots of investors, the appeal of valuable metals is hard to resistmost especially, gold. It is among the most sought-after and popular financial investments in the world because it can provide profitable returns in any financial investment portfolio. Gold is typically thought about to be a safe investment and a hedge against inflation due to the fact that the rate of the metal goes up when the U.S. dollar decreases. Something investors require to consider is that most 401( k) retirement strategies do not enable the direct ownership of physical gold or gold derivatives such as futures or alternatives contracts. taxes on 401k rollover to gold. However, there are some indirect methods to get your hands on some gold in your 401( k).



Nevertheless, gold Individual retirement accounts do exist that focus on holding valuable metals for retirement cost savings. Investors can however discover specific shared funds or ETFs that hold gold or gold mining stocks through their 401( k) s. Rolling over a 401( k) to a self-directed IRA may give financiers greater access to more varied types of investment in gold. 401k gold ira rollover gold storage. A 401( k) strategy is a self-directed employer-sponsored retirement cost savings plan. Offered by many companies, millions of Americans rely on these tax-advantaged investment plans to help them live out their retirement years comfortably. People can divert part of their salary on a pretax basis towards long-lasting financial investments, with numerous employers providing to make partial or even 100% matching contributions to the cash invested in the strategy by workers.
